Google Pixel 9a: the "low cost" smartphone would arrive earlier than expected

Generally expected around May, the affordable version Google's latest smartphone could well be released sooner. The Google Pixel 9a is already rumored to be provided with an early release date.

Google seems to be in a hurry to release new phones. While the latest Google Pixel 9, Pixel 9 Pro, and Pixel 9 Pro Fold were released two months ahead of schedule, rumors are that the company's next device is also expected to be a bit ahead of schedule.

According to Android Headlines, the Google Pixel 9a is already well advanced in its design. Generally expected for May/June, the “a” versions Google phones are more affordable than the main range. The Google Pixel 9a would be no exception and would even have a revised and new design as demonstrated by OnLeaks on X (formerly Twitter) who was able to get their hands on early designs of the Pixel 9a.

We are therefore observing a camera module that is very different from those found on the Pixel 9. Although we do not yet have official information on the Google Pixel 9a, it would not be surprising if the latter does not have the same sensors found on the main Pixel 9 series. This would allow Google to reduce production costs and offer its Pixel 9a at a more affordable price.

Still according to Android Headlines, the Google Pixel 9a would therefore benefit from an earlier release date in March. This could put it in competition with the next Redmi Note 14 from Xiaomi planned for the same period.
